
Revolution II Fall to New York Red Bulls II, 4-1
June 4, 2023 - MLS NEXT Pro (MLS NEXT Pro)
New England Revolution II News Release
MONTCLAIR, N.J. - New England Revolution II (7-4-1; 23 pts.) fell to New York Red Bulls II (6-3-3; 23 pts.), 4-1, on Sunday night at MSU Soccer Park. Homegrown midfielder Jack Panayotou tallied his first goal of the season in the match while Revolution goalkeeper Jacob Jackson made 12 saves, marking a new career high.
New York found the scoresheet first with Julian Hall tallying in the fourth minute. Panayotou brought New England back level three minutes later, netting a cross from forward Malcolm Fry. Oladayo Thomas and Ronald Donkor each scored to give New York a 3-1 lead heading into halftime. New York's Ibrahim Kasule added on to the scoring in the 71st minute to secure a 4-1 win for Red Bulls II.
New England returns to action on Sunday, June 11 to host Chicago Fire II at Gillette Stadium. The 8 p.m. match will stream live on MLSNEXTPro.com.

Homegrown midfielder Jack Panayotou tallied his first goal in his fourth appearance with Revolution II this season.
Panayotou's tally came in the seventh minute, marking Revolution II's quickest goal of the season since defender Pierre Cayet's headed goal in the eighth minute against Inter Miami II last week.
Revolution goalkeeper Jacob Jackson made a career-high 12 saves in the match. The 2022 MLS SuperDraft first round pick recorded his first consecutive starts of the season for Revolution II.
Forward Malcolm Fry registered his second assist of the season on Panayotou's goal and logged 66 minutes to surpass 1,000 minutes played with New England's second team.
Defender Colby Quiñones played the full 90 in his 60th career appearance with Revolution II.
Academy forward Olger Escobar entered in the 84th minute, marking his third appearance with New England's second team.

POSTGAME QUOTES: New England Revolution II 1 vs. New York Red Bulls II 4
Revolution II Head Coach Clint Peay
On his assessment of the match:
Peay: "Obviously, a difficult match for the guys. I thought that we were very indecisive in how we wanted to play. And I thought that from just a standpoint of hustle and determination, Red Bull had more desire in that regard today than we did, but I think some bad decisions in our build up and the intent to capitalize off what Red Bull was giving us wasn't there from our collective tonight."
On Jacob Jackson making a career-high 12 saves:
Peay: "Yeah, look, he [Jacob Jackson] is good. He's a good shot stopper. There are areas of his game that can still improve, and I think that's with the ball at his feet and decision making, but in terms of being able to make stops, he does an excellent job."
On Jack Panayotou's first goal of the season:
Peay: "Opportunistic goal, obviously it was a good time. We had just conceded so it helped to get back to even and he [Jack Panayotou] worked hard. I thought that he could have contributed a little bit more offensively for us, but he put in a good effort."
On the focus heading into the week to prep for Chicago Fire II:
Peay: "I think the focus will be trying to improve upon the areas where we struggled this week. And that's decision making and build up and having a better collective understanding of how we want to execute the game plan."
